Answer to Question 1

Relief is the difference in elevation between two locations. The highest point on Earth is Mount Everest at 8850 meters above sea level. The lowest point on Earth is the Mariana trench at 11,040 meters below sea level. The variation in relief exhibited on Earth's surface is 19,890 meters.
